Minister of Islamic Affairs inspects the Conditions of our Pilgrims in Medina

Nouakchott

The Minister of Islamic Affairs and Original Education, Mr. Sid Yahia Ould Cheikhna Ould Lamrabet, together with members of the official delegation, visited on Saturday evening to inspect the conditions of Mauritanian pilgrims in Medina.

The Minister explained that the visit comes within the framework of accompanying our pilgrims and checking their conditions in line with the plan drawn up by the sector this year, under the directives of the President of the Republic, Mr. Mohamed Ould Cheikh Ghazouani.

He explained that after the visit and after exchanging conversations with the pilgrims, he confirmed that the indicators are positive, both in terms of the dealings of the supervisors with them, as well as in terms of living and accommodation conditions, noting that the hotel where our pilgrims are staying, which can accommodate 1,000 pilgrims, is only a few meters away from the Prophet’s Mosque, which is the first time that the conditions of the pilgrims are of this quality for the first time.

He said he instructed the organizers to prepare for the movement of pilgrims from Madinah to Mecca, to implement the plan to the fullest, and to benefit from past experiences in this field, noting that the next stage requires tight coordination.
